**Mgmt Meeting Minutes — Retiring the Brightline Range**

Quick recap for sales leads at Fenholt Supplies: we agreed to retire the Brightline fixture range by year-end. Remaining stock moves to clearance pricing next month, and accounts on standing orders get migrated to the Lumetta range. Trade-in incentives were approved in principle. The confidential note on next steps sits just below.

board note of bajof-bajeg: The pricing group signed off on a budget of $13.4 million for Project Sildor. The renewal with Lamixek Holdings closes at $48.9 million a year, 49 percent above the last contract.

**Q: Where's the evacuation-chair store, and how do we get in?**
It's the small room behind the lift lobby on Level 3 at Brindleworth House — look for the green signage. Team assistants may need access during fire warden checks or quarterly kit inspections for the Halloway programme. Don't prop the door; it's alarmed after hours. If the chair's been used or looks damaged, flag it to the duty warden straight away. The door pass code is below.

turnstile pass: bdg-ZSSRD-5

Runbook: string extraction (Quillbatch)

Run the extractor after every merge to the localization branch. It scans the Fernhollow app tree, pulls marked strings, and pushes a catalog to the translation queue. Do not run it against feature branches; duplicates pollute the queue and the vendor bills per string. If the script exits nonzero, check that the catalog schema version matches the queue's expected version before retrying. Output goes to the shared drop directory. The extractor reads its runtime settings from the block below:

config for fahip-yaweg:
[rusax]
port = 9090
team = gormir
host = rusax.orvexio.corp
region = outer-4
access_code = ac_9be542
timeout_ms = 1500